Shuang Fang is a scholar working on Plant Science, Molecular Biology and Ecology, Evolution, Behavior and Systematics. According to data from OpenAlex, Shuang Fang has authored 28 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Plant Science, 13 papers in Molecular Biology and 3 papers in Ecology, Evolution, Behavior and Systematics. Recurrent topics in Shuang Fang’s work include Plant Molecular Biology Research (16 papers), Plant Stress Responses and Tolerance (7 papers) and Plant nutrient uptake and metabolism (6 papers). Shuang Fang is often cited by papers focused on Plant Molecular Biology Research (16 papers), Plant Stress Responses and Tolerance (7 papers) and Plant nutrient uptake and metabolism (6 papers). Shuang Fang collaborates with scholars based in China, Australia and Canada. Shuang Fang's co-authors include Jinfang Chu, Cunyu Yan, Joseph P. Noel, Yongxia Guo, Dingbang Ma, Xu Li, Hongtao Liu, Zhonghai Li, Bosheng Li and Hongwei Guo and has published in prestigious journals such as Proceedings of the National Academy of Sciences, The Plant Cell and PLANT PHYSIOLOGY.
